The F52 error means your LG range detected a short circuit in the griddle sensor. This is different from the F51 error which is a general sensor fault — F52 specifically indicates an electrical short in the griddle sensor circuit. When this happens the range cannot safely monitor or regulate griddle temperature and stops the function. A circuit breaker reset clears it in some cases but if F52 keeps returning the griddle sensor or its wiring will need to be inspected and replaced by a technician.
Common causes
- Griddle sensor has developed an internal short circuit
- Wiring to the griddle sensor is damaged causing a short
- Moisture or debris causing a short circuit in the griddle sensor circuit
How to fix it
-
1
Turn off the circuit breaker for the range and wait 30 seconds
-
2
Turn the circuit breaker back on and check if the error has cleared
-
3
If F52 persists after resetting the griddle sensor and its wiring needs inspection and replacement by a qualified technician
